The event is designed to highlight mining-supported manufacturing ventures and provide a crucial networking platform for emerging entrepreneurs.
Briefing journalists on Tuesday, BCM's CEO, Charles Siwawa, stressed that the summit’s focus is on addressing critical issues such as economic diversification, growth, citizen empowerment, and job creation. Siwawa highlighted BCM’s collaboration with the government to promote industrialisation through SME growth.
